College Student’s Superhero Video Catches The Eye Of Hollywood Bosses

It’s not often that a TikTok video gets attention for the right reasons. The micro-video social site is usually a landfill of mediocre dance videos and other randomness – until now.

Julian Bass, a 20-year-old Georgia State University theatre major, recently went viral with the coolest superhero video ever. In the teen’s self-produced, 20-second clip set to “Watermelon Sugar” by Harry Styles, Bass transforms into his favourite heroes – a Jedi Knight, Ben 10 and Spider-Man.

The video also includes some pretty awesome scene changes.

Two of the three featured heroes are owned by the Walt Disney Company and Bass urged viewers to share the video, hoping that the folks from Disney might see it.

“If y’all can retweet enough times that Disney calls, that’d be greatly appreciated”, he said on Twitter.

if y’all can retweet this enough times that Disney calls, that’d be greatly appreciated pic.twitter.com/GrKlIRxg3J

— Julian Bass (@thejulianbass) July 2, 2020


The tweet has since garnered more than 1.3 million likes, 568.7k retweets and over 9000 responses.

And thanks to the sheer volume of shares, Julian managed to get the attention of Disney Executive Chairman and former CEO Bob Iger, who replied in the best way possible – “The world’s gonna know your name!!!”

To which Julian responded, “This is the beginning!!!” and “Let’s schedule a time to talk!!!” in consecutive tweets.

The world’s gonna know your name!!!

— Robert Iger (@RobertIger) July 3, 2020


The video also got the attention of Sony, who replied simply with side-eye and mind-blown emojis. Guardians of the Galaxy and Suicide Squad director James Gunn tweeted the praise-hands emoji. While Scrubs alum, Zach Braff said, “Hire this man, Gunn!”

Other famous folks who noticed the video were Luke Skywalker himself, Mark Hamill, and Josh Gad, who voices Olaf in both Frozen movies.

The superhero video has proved very popular among fans, prompting them to call for Julian to be cast as protagonist Miles Morales in a live-action version of Spider-Man: Into the Spider-Verse.

Bass reiterated the sentiment in a few interviews about the experience, claiming that he now feels as though he’s in the running to potentially be cast as Miles Morales‘ Spider-Man.

Whether anything comes of this speculative casting remains to be seen. But then again, stranger things have happened.
